Selling a home in Spartanburg, South Carolina has taken on an entirely new character in recent years. Once overshadowed by its larger neighbor to the south, Spartanburg has stepped confidently into its own identity — a city with deep manufacturing roots, a reimagined downtown anchored by Morgan Square, and a growing reputation as one of the Southeast’s most livable mid-sized metros.
The numbers back it up. Spartanburg County has attracted consistent investment from global employers like BMW, Denny’s corporate headquarters, and a widening network of automotive suppliers and logistics firms that have transformed the region into a genuine economic hub. Meanwhile, the arrival of the USC Upstate campus, Wofford College, and Converse University keeps the city intellectually energized and draws a steady stream of young professionals who quickly realize Spartanburg offers something increasingly rare: real quality of life at a price that still makes sense.
The housing market has absorbed all of that energy. Median home prices in Spartanburg currently sit in the range of $230,000 to $270,000 — lower than Greenville, but climbing steadily as buyers priced out of larger markets discover what locals have always known. Here’s the reality of how homes sell today: buyers find listings online. Zillow, Realtor.com, Redfin — these platforms have completely transformed how people shop for homes, from the couch, on their phones, often before they’ve even spoken to an agent. But those platforms don’t generate listings on their own. They pull data from the Spartanburg Association of REALTORS® (SAR) MLS, and that’s exactly where your home needs to appear.
A Flat Fee MLS service gives you that same MLS placement — the identical exposure that traditional listing agents provide — for a fraction of the cost. You keep control of your sale, you can still offer a buyer’s agent commission to attract agent-represented buyers (which most FSBO sellers wisely do), and you skip the thousands you’d otherwise hand over just to get listed.
